The water-based adhesive market has experienced steady growth in recent years, driven by increasing demand from industries such as packaging, construction, automotive, woodworking, and textiles. Water-based adhesives use water as a carrier instead of solvents, making them more environmentally friendly and less hazardous. They are widely preferred for their low VOC (volatile organic compound) emissions, non-toxic formulation, and ease of use. Water-based adhesives offer strong bonding strength, quick drying times, and excellent resistance to moisture and temperature variations, making them suitable for a wide range of applications.

The growing emphasis on sustainable and eco-friendly adhesives, coupled with stringent environmental regulations on solvent-based adhesives, has accelerated the shift toward water-based adhesive solutions. Advancements in polymer and resin technologies have further improved the performance and versatility of water-based adhesives market, enabling them to replace traditional solvent-based adhesives in many industrial and consumer applications. The increasing use of water-based adhesives in the packaging industry, particularly for flexible packaging and labeling, has been a major driver of market growth.

Market Drivers and Trends

1. Rising Demand for Eco-Friendly and Low-VOC Adhesives

Environmental concerns and increasing regulations on the use of solvent-based adhesives have led to a growing demand for water-based adhesives. Governments and regulatory bodies such as the Environmental Protection Agency (EPA) and the European Union have implemented strict guidelines to limit the use of volatile organic compounds (VOCs) and hazardous chemicals in adhesive formulations.

Water-based adhesives are free from toxic solvents, making them safer for workers and reducing the environmental impact of adhesive production and application. Their low odor, non-flammable nature, and easy clean-up with water make them more convenient for industrial and consumer use. The rising trend toward sustainable manufacturing and green building has further supported the adoption of water-based adhesives.

2. Growing Use in the Packaging Industry

The packaging industry is one of the largest consumers of water-based adhesives, particularly for applications such as carton sealing, paper lamination, labeling, and flexible packaging. Water-based adhesives offer strong adhesion to various substrates, including paper, cardboard, plastics, and metal foils, ensuring reliable and durable bonding.

The increasing demand for eco-friendly and biodegradable packaging solutions has driven the use of water-based adhesives in the production of food-safe and recyclable packaging materials. The shift toward lightweight and flexible packaging to reduce transportation costs and environmental impact has further boosted the demand for high-performance water-based adhesive solutions.

3. Expanding Construction and Woodworking Sector

The construction industry has witnessed increased use of water-based adhesives for flooring, wall panels, tiles, insulation materials, and roofing systems. Water-based adhesives provide strong bonding and flexibility, making them ideal for high-stress applications in construction and interior design.

In the woodworking sector, water-based adhesives are widely used for furniture assembly, lamination, and veneer bonding due to their ease of application, quick drying time, and compatibility with various wood substrates. The growing trend toward sustainable construction materials and green building certification programs such as LEED (Leadership in Energy and Environmental Design) has supported the adoption of water-based adhesives in the construction sector.

4. Increasing Application in Automotive and Transportation

The automotive and transportation industries have adopted water-based adhesives for applications such as interior trim bonding, seating assembly, gasket attachment, and weatherstripping. Water-based adhesives provide excellent resistance to heat, moisture, and mechanical stress, ensuring long-lasting performance in automotive environments.

The growing production of electric vehicles (EVs) has increased the demand for lightweight materials and adhesive solutions that improve vehicle efficiency and reduce emissions. Water-based adhesives offer a sustainable alternative to traditional solvent-based adhesives, helping automotive manufacturers meet environmental regulations and improve overall vehicle performance.

5. Technological Advancements in Polymer and Resin Formulations

Advancements in polymer and resin chemistry have improved the performance, durability, and versatility of water-based adhesives. New formulations based on acrylic, polyurethane (PU), polyvinyl acetate (PVA), and natural latex offer enhanced bonding strength, flexibility, and resistance to heat, moisture, and UV exposure.

The development of high-performance water-based adhesives with improved drying times, extended shelf life, and resistance to harsh environmental conditions has expanded their application in demanding industries such as electronics, automotive, and marine. Innovations in nano-technology and bio-based polymers have further enhanced the adhesive properties and environmental benefits of water-based adhesives.
